TWO (noun): one of the four playing cards in a deck that have two spots. Additional senses: the cardinal number that is the sum of one and one or a numeral representing this number; being one more than one; "he received two messages".
In standard Scrabble scoring, TWO totals 6 points before multipliers. That sum uses official letter values: common tiles (A, E, I, O, U, L, N, S, T, R) are worth 1, while D and G are 2, B, C, M, P are 3, F, H, V, W, Y are 4, K is 5, J and X are 8, and Q and Z are 10.
